Standards, rights and duties of teachers, officials and employees in combined schools in Vietnam

According to Article 11 of the regulation on organization and operation of private primary schools, middle schools, high schools and combined schools promulgated together with Circular 40/2021/TT-BGDĐT, standards, rights and duties of teachers, officials and employees in combined schools are as follows:

1. Each teacher, official and employee of a private school must meet requirements for professional standards, standardized educational qualifications as prescribed by the Law on Education, the Charter of private schools and other regulations of the Law.

2. Each teacher, official and employee shall fulfill all duties as mentioned in the labor contracts concluded with the school; have rights and duties as prescribed in the Law on Education and the Charter of private schools and other regulations of the Law.

Requirements pertaining to tenured teacher rate and quota on teachers and employees in combined schools in Vietnam

Pursuant to Article 12 of the regulation on organization and operation of private primary schools, middle schools, high schools and combined schools promulgated together with Circular 40/2021/TT-BGDĐT, requirements pertaining to tenured teacher rate and quota on teachers and employees in combined schools are as follows:

1. The private school must ensure that the ratio of number of tenured teachers to total number of teachers in the first school year shall comply with the regulations on the public schools as follow: primary schools: 90%; middle schools and high schools: at least 40%.

2. The number of teachers and employees of the private school may not be smaller than the quota on teachers, employees for each grade as prescribed in regulations of the State.
